Before starting your Crochet Flower Desk Lamp Free Pattern, gather the following materials to make your project easy and enjoyable.
First, choose yarn that complements the look you want for your lamp. Cotton yarn is ideal for structure and durability, while acrylic yarn gives a softer, glowing effect when the light shines through. You’ll need colors for petals, leaves, and stems—traditional flower tones like red, pink, white, yellow, and green work beautifully, but you can also explore pastel or gradient shades for a modern touch.
Select a crochet hook that suits your yarn weight—usually between 2.0 mm and 3.5 mm for delicate flowers. Smaller hooks create tighter, more defined stitches that hold their shape around the wire frame.
For the structure, you’ll need floral wire or copper wire, which allows you to shape petals and stems naturally. Cover the wire with floral tape or green yarn to make it look realistic.
Lighting is an essential part of the Crochet Flower Desk Lamp Free Pattern. Choose LED fairy lights or a USB-powered LED bulb—these options are safe, energy-efficient, and don’t generate heat, which protects your yarn.
You’ll also need scissors, a yarn needle, hot glue, and wire cutters for assembly. Finally, find a lamp base, ceramic pot, or glass jar to hold the finished arrangement.
Follow these steps carefully to complete your Crochet Flower Desk Lamp Free Pattern from start to finish. Each part of the project can be adjusted to suit your style and flower choice.
Step 1: Crochet the Flower Petals
Begin by making your petals. Chain 6–10 stitches, then work single crochet (sc), half double crochet (hdc), and double crochet (dc) along the chain to form a petal shape. You can adjust stitch counts for larger or smaller petals. Make 5–8 petals for each flower. When finished, sew the petals together in a circle, layering them to form a full blossom.
Step 2: Crochet the Leaves
For leaves, chain 12–15 stitches and work sc up one side and down the other, increasing at the tip to create a rounded edge. Add a slip stitch along the middle for texture. Make several leaves to fill out your arrangement.
Step 3: Add Structure with Wire
Insert floral wire through the base of each flower and leaf. Wrap the stems with floral tape or green yarn to cover the wire and give a natural look. This makes it easy to bend and position the flowers later.
Step 4: Add the Lighting
Carefully wrap LED fairy lights around the stems and weave them through the flowers. You can also place small LED bulbs under or inside the petals to make the flowers glow from within. Use a small dab of hot glue to secure the lights, but don’t cover the LEDs.
Step 5: Assemble the Lamp
Insert the wired stems into your chosen lamp base or jar. Arrange them to create a balanced, natural bouquet look. Adjust the height of each stem to give depth and dimension to your design.
Step 6: Final Details
Add small details like crocheted buds, vines, or decorative ribbons. Check that all the lights work properly before finishing. Once complete, turn off the room lights and admire the warm glow of your handmade flower lamp.
The Crochet Flower Desk Lamp Free Pattern gives you endless opportunities to express creativity. You can design your lamp to suit any mood, season, or décor theme.
For a classic romantic look, use red or pink roses with warm white lights. For a fresh spring design, crochet daisies or tulips in soft pastel colors. A bohemian-inspired lamp can feature wildflowers in mixed shades and natural tones like mustard, terracotta, and cream.
If you prefer something modern, try using neutral yarn colors like beige, white, and sage green, paired with a wooden or metal base for a minimalist style. You can even make seasonal lamps—pastels for spring, bright colors for summer, rustic orange for autumn, and white poinsettias for winter.
Don’t be afraid to combine different flower types in one lamp for a garden-like effect. Mixing textures, petal shapes, and lighting placements can make your lamp more dynamic and visually striking. You can also experiment with yarn that has metallic threads or slight shimmer for extra glow.
To get the best results from your Crochet Flower Desk Lamp Free Pattern, follow these expert tips to ensure durability and beauty.
Maintain even tension while crocheting. Tight stitches help the petals keep their shape and prevent sagging when attached to the wire. If your stitches are too loose, your flowers might not stand up well.
When shaping the flowers, use wire only where necessary—too much can make the lamp heavy. Focus on wiring the stems and outer edges of petals for a lifelike appearance.
Always use LED lights, since they stay cool and safe. Avoid any light source that produces heat, as it could damage the yarn or pose a safety risk.
For a polished look, hide all visible wires and glue carefully. Wrap the light cord neatly down the stem and secure it inside the base.
If your lamp feels unstable, add pebbles, marbles, or clay inside the base for extra weight. This ensures your lamp stands securely on your desk or table.
Finally, take your time arranging the flowers. The more natural and balanced your bouquet looks, the more professional and elegant your finished lamp will appear.
1. Is the Crochet Flower Desk Lamp Free Pattern suitable for beginners?
Yes! The pattern uses basic stitches and simple assembly methods, so even beginners can follow it easily with a bit of patience.
2. What type of yarn gives the best lighting effect?
Acrylic yarn is excellent for soft light diffusion, while cotton yarn offers sharper stitch definition and structure.
3. Are LED lights safe to use with crochet materials?
Yes, LED lights are completely safe. They don’t produce heat, making them ideal for use with yarn.
4. Can I use different flower types in one lamp?
Absolutely! Mixing roses, daisies, or tulips can create a beautiful bouquet-style lamp that feels more natural and artistic.
5. How can I clean my crochet lamp?
Avoid washing. Gently dust your lamp using a soft brush or cloth to maintain its beauty.
6. What can I use as a base for my lamp?
You can use a recycled jar, small pot, or traditional lamp base—just make sure it’s sturdy enough to hold the stems.
